美文网首页论程序员自我修养
Windows 下升级mysql 5.6到5.7

Windows 下升级mysql 5.6到5.7

作者: 风也醉 | 来源:发表于2020-05-14 11:17 被阅读0次

Mysql的升级方式分为两种:原地升级逻辑升级。这两种升级方式,本质没有什么区别的。

只是在对数据文件的处理上有些区别而已。原地升级是直接将数据文件进行拷贝,而逻辑升级对数据文件的处理方式是通过逻辑导出导入,需要用到mysqldump

逻辑升级大家都理解,这种方式在数据量比较大的情况下花费时间比较长。所以今天我们来讲讲原地升级

1.将现有的mysql关闭。使用cmd窗口,进入到mysql目录下面,将mysql服务移除,先从服务中找到mysql服务的名称。

mysql

然后执行remove操作    D:\mysql\mysql-5.6.32-winx64\bin>mysqld --remove MYSQL

2.下载最新的mysql5.7压缩包。

下载地址:https://dev.mysql.com/downloads/mysql/

最新的mysql5.7的压缩包解压开你会发现,没有data目录和my.ini文件,跟之前的版本不一样。 

3.将之前mysql5.6的data目录和my.ini文件拷贝至mysql5.7下。

这个地方要注意:my.ini中,版本5.6的配置,有一些在版本5.7下面已经不能用了。

4.将mysql5.7的服务添加到win的服务队列中,并且启动mysql服务。

将mysql5.7的服务添加到win的服务队列中,然后启动mysql服务,这边我们为了方便知道服务,所以将服务名字命名为mysql5.7

6.升级成功后,再次重启mysql5.7服务

net stop mysql5.7

net start mysql5.7

7.安装升级完成。

相关文章

  • Windows 下升级mysql 5.6到5.7

    Mysql的升级方式分为两种:原地升级和逻辑升级。这两种升级方式,本质没有什么区别的。 只是在对数据文件的处理上有...

  • Mysql 5.6升级到5.7爬坑记

    MariaDB 10.0 对应 Mysql 5.6 MariaDB 10.1 对应 Mysql 5.7 升级的正确...

  • MySQL5.7升级问题

    当我们将mysql升级到5.7时, 而使用的database是之前5.6留下的, 如果此时执行一些sql操作会报错...

  • mysql 5.6 升级到 mysq 5.7

    在若依框架中需要把 数据库升级,否在linux中,定时任务的表导不进去。下载地址:http://mirrors.s...

  • MySQL的这个bug,坑了多少人?

    问题描述 近期,线上有个重要Mysql客户的表在从5.6升级到5.7后,master上插入过程中出现"Duplic...

  • mysql 安装

    包含 windows、linux、mac下mysql安装,linux下MariaDB安装 下载 MySQL 5.7...

  • MySQL5.7插入数据+“secure-file-priv”错

    MySQL5.7插入数据+“secure-file-priv”错误,MYSQL5.7和MYSQL5.6在使用和功能...

  • 安装 MySQL 5.7 压缩包版

    自MySQL版本升级到5.7以后,其安装及配置过程和原来版本发生了很大的变化,下面详细介绍5.7版本MySQL的下...

  • 如何在Windows下安装MySQL

    Windows下安装MySQL5.7 首先我们需要获取到MySQL的安装包,这里推荐安装的是MySQL5.7的解压...

  • 全备恢复

    MySQL 5.7、5.6或5.5实例:安装 Percona XtraBackup 2.4MySQL 8.0实例,...

网友评论

    本文标题:Windows 下升级mysql 5.6到5.7

    本文链接:https://www.haomeiwen.com/subject/upzlmctx.html